Overview
SyntaxHighlighter Plus is a robust WordPress plugin designed for code syntax highlighting, building upon the original work of Matt, Viper007Bond, and mdawaffe. This plugin allows users to effortlessly post syntax-highlighted code snippets while preserving their formatting and without requiring manual adjustments. Supporting a wide range of programming languages including Bash, C++, C#, CSS, JavaScript, Python, and many more, it ensures that developers can showcase their code clearly and effectively. Utilizing the SyntaxHighlighter JavaScript package by Alex Gorbatchev, the plugin offers flexible BBCode methods for embedding code, making it easy to integrate code snippets with customizable syntax.
Supports Multiple Programming Languages
- Covers a wide range of languages including Bash, C++, C#, CSS, Delphi, Diff, Groovy, Java, JavaScript, Perl, PHP, Plain text, Python, Ruby, Scala, SQL, VB, and XML/HTML.
- Provides aliases for each language to make it easier to use in posts.
Easy Syntax Highlighting
- Allows you to post syntax highlighted code without losing its formatting.
- No need for manual changes to the code for highlighting.
Flexible BBCode Methods
- Offers multiple BBCode methods to insert code, such as [sourcecode], [source], [code], and [lang].
- Supports shorter and neater syntax by allowing omission of quotation marks around the language.
Enhanced Version
- An enhanced version of the original SyntaxHighlighter by Matt, Viper007Bond, and mdawaffe.
- Built on the SyntaxHighlighter JavaScript package by Alex Gorbatchev.
